CGC STRIKE FORCE SEIZES PANGOLIN SCALES WORTH BILLIONS OF NAIRA.
The CGC strike force ably led by Deputy Controller Ahmadu Shuaib has continued to decimate the ranks of smugglers in a bid to curb economic and social sabotage. The unit has seized a arge haul of Pangolin scales worth billions of naira in Lagos as the vehicles carrying the scales were intercepted and this is remarkable because it represents one of the biggest seizures of the product made in one day by the Customs Service.
The Strike Force working on credible information and intelligence were said to have intercepted the more than 110 sacks of the prohibited products neatly parked in some vehicles along the Ijora-Apapa road in readiness for export.

Three suspects were also apprehended and they are presently in detention at the Customs formation.
The product which is in high demand abroad due to its medicinal values has become a big time trade undertaken by smugglers in collusion with other economic saboteurs.
The value of the Pangolin scales has not been completely determined as sorting is still ongoing at the Customs Command, but a rough estimate put the value into billions of naira.
Pangolin has become an endangered animal as it is hunted for its highly priced meat and even higher priced scales which are used in making pharmaceutical and household products.
Nigerians have been urged to stop the poaching of the animal because it could go extinct soon. Roasted Pangolin scales are believed to cure cancer, relieve palsy and even stimulate breast milk.
It is considered a delicacy in China, Vietnam and other parts of South East Asia. The scales are priced 3000 dollars per Kilogram, while the meat is 300 dollars per kilogram. Live Pangolin attracts 1000 dollars based on black market price.
About 10,000 Pangolins are poached annually.
